High‐Entropy Liquid Metal Process for Transparent Ultrathin p‐Type Gallium Oxide

open access: yesAdvanced Functional Materials, EarlyView.
This work introduces a doping strategy for harvesting ultrathin Ga oxide layers using a multi‐elemental Ga‐based liquid metal alloy. The incorporation of trivalent In metal into the self‐limiting oxide formed on the alloy's surface is enabled by the existence of atomically dispersed Pt, Au, and Pd.

Biodegradable, Humidity‐Insensitive Mask‐Integrated E‐Nose for Sustainable and Non‐Invasive Continuous Breath Analysis

open access: yesAdvanced Functional Materials, EarlyView.
This study introduces a paper‐based biodegradable, humidity‐insensitive e‐nose for real‐time breath analysis, addressing challenges in existing technologies such as humidity interference, high costs, and environmental impact. Featuring hydrophobic polymer coatings, these sensors reliably detect VOCs even in high‐moisture environments.

Dual‐Mode Film Based on Highly Scattering Nanofibers and Upcycled Chips‐Bags for Year‐Round Thermal Management

open access: yesAdvanced Functional Materials, EarlyView.
Intelligent radiative cooling devices, adaptable to various weather conditions, have the potential for year‐round energy savings. This study introduces a sustainable dual‐mode film made from polycaprolactone nanofibers and upcycled chip bags for effective thermal management.
